#54dff4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54dff4 is composed of 32.9% red, 87.5%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.6% cyan, 8.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 187.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 64.3%. #54dff4 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#00bfe9.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#54dff4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54dff4 has RGB values of R:84, G:223,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5562356.

Shades and Tints of #54dff4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c0d is the darkest color, while #fafe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#54dff4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a6a7 is the less saturated color, while #4de4fb is the most saturated one.
